Help is on hand next week for sixth-formers around the Island searching for the right university course.
Eighty universities and higher education colleges have been invited to a conference to answer questions from students and parents making that important decision.
There'll also be advice on taking a gap year, theological training, and the options available at an agricultural college.
It's all on offer at Ballakermeen High School next Thursday and Friday (June 19 and 20).
Head of Sixth Form Ian Kay says colleges and unviersities are keen to recruit here - as Manx students have proved a good bet (audio file attached):
